What is the IELTS Test?
The IELTS test assesses a prospect's capability to interact efficiently in English throughout 4 essential areas: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. It is available in 2 formats: Academic and General Training.
- Academic IELTS: This version appropriates for individuals who wish to study at undergraduate or postgraduate levels in English-speaking nations or seek expert registration.
- General Training IELTS: This format is focused on those who are planning to undertake non-academic training or work experience, or move to an English-speaking nation.
Structure of the IELTS Test
The IELTS test is developed to be completed over a single day, with the Speaking test perhaps arranged on a various day. Here is a comprehensive breakdown of each area:
-
Listening (30 minutes):
- Format: Candidates listen to 4 tape-recorded texts and address 40 questions.
- Function: To evaluate the capability to understand spoken English, consisting of discussions, monologues, and conversations.
-
Reading (60 minutes):
- Academic: Three long texts of increasing problem, taken from books, journals, publications, and newspapers.
- General Training: Three areas with texts of varying lengths and styles, consisting of notifications, ads, and articles.
- Function: To assess reading understanding and the ability to identify and understand crucial info.
-
Writing (60 minutes):
- Academic: Two jobs. Task 1 includes describing a graph, table, chart, or diagram. Task 2 needs composing an essay in action to a perspective, argument, or problem.
- General Training: Two jobs. Job 1 involves composing a letter inquiring or describing a scenario. Job 2 requires composing an essay.
- Function: To examine the capability to compose in a clear, coherent, and structured way.
-
Speaking (11-14 minutes):
- Format: A face-to-face interview with a certified IELTS inspector, divided into 3 parts.
- Part 1: Introduction and interview (4-5 minutes).
- Part 2: Long turn (3-4 minutes), where the prospect speaks about an offered topic.
- Part 3: Discussion (4-5 minutes) on the topic from Part 2.
- Function: To evaluate spoken English abilities, consisting of fluency, coherence, and pronunciation.
Scoring System
The IELTS test is scored on a scale of 0 to 9, with 9 being the highest. Each area (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king) is scored individually, and these scores are averaged to produce a total band score. The scoring criteria for each area are as follows:
- Listening and Reading: Each right response is granted one mark. The overall score is then converted to the IELTS 9-band scale.
- Composing: Assessed based on Task Achievement/Task Response, Coherence and Cohesion, Lexical Resource, and Grammatical Range and Accuracy.
- Speaking: Evaluated on Fluency and Coherence, Lexical Resource, Grammatical Range and Accuracy, and Pronunciation.

Frequently asked questions About the IELTS Certificate
Q: How long is the IELTS certificate legitimate?
- A: The IELTS certificate is generally legitimate for 2 years, although some companies may accept ratings older than this duration if they can confirm the prospect's existing English proficiency.
Q: Can I retake the IELTS test?
- A: Yes, candidates can retake the IELTS test as sometimes as they wish, however they should wait a minimum of 90 days in between test efforts.
Q: What score do I require for university admission?
- A: The necessary score differs by institution and program. Normally, a score of 6.5 or higher is common for undergraduate programs, while 7.0 or higher is often required for postgraduate studies.
Q: Is the IELTS test accepted in the USA?
- A: Yes, over 3,400 organizations in the USA accept IELTS scores. Nevertheless, some universities might also need TOEFL ratings.
